    I'd just replace the whole compressor, special tools are required to replace the AC pulley/bearings. And in the end you still have a compressor that is 16+ years old and could choke out at any time.

    They sell bulbs for the cluster, remove and replace should fix it.

    Pics of the subframe spots??

    I have a feeling it's not the subframe, as that is the large metal square that holds the motor/trans to the bottom of the car.
